TCAT Admission Requirements
TCAT programs are first come, first served. While you may meet the admission requirements for a particular program, you are not guaranteed a seat in the class.
Returning students who have previously attended college or already have a college degree should submit a copy of their transcript to the Admissions Office for evaluation, as he or she may be exempt from the admissions test requirement.
- All first-time TCAT students must meet eligibility requirements through appropriate scores on the ACT or SAT tests. (See requirements for various programs below.)
- Students who have not taken ACT or SAT may take the ACCUPLACER tests, offered free of charge through the Chattanooga State Testing Center.
- All TCAT programs except Practical Nursing require the ACCUPLACER Reading & Arithmetic test.
- Practical Nursing applicants must instead take the ACCUPLACER Reading & Quantitative Reasoning tests.
- Commercial Truck Driving (CDL) Program requires CDL permit for admittance.
TCAT Age Limits
- 17 and under - with a high school diploma or GED.
(Note: students are not eligible for the Commercial Truck Driving program until they're age 18.)
- 18 or over - no high school diploma or GED is required for most programs.
(Note: a high school / GED / HiSet Diploma IS required for Federal Financial Aid. There is no minimum GPA requirement.)

Minimum Test Score / Placement Level
Prospective students must meet a program's minimum test score or placement level to register for that program.
Passing of college level or required development courses can be used as placement. As well as equivalent earned scores on EdReady, SAT, or Compass. Test scores must be less than 5 years old for placement.

Accuplacer: Testing at Chattanooga State
All Accuplacer testing will be facilitated by appointment at the Chattanooga State Testing Center (IMC-122) on the main campus or at the Dayton or Kimball site. Students are allowed to take each subject test a maximum of two times per term. Most students will take the TCAT Reading and TCAT Math (Arithmetic) tests for entry into majority of our TCAT programs. However, some programs do require a different Accuplacer test so be sure to check with TCAT Student Services for specific test.
